The Lanhi tunnel steel arch frame installation vehicle is a specialized vehicle used for erecting and installing arch frames. Its design integrates multiple functions and mechanisms, making arch frame installation more efficient and safer. This article will detail the components and characteristics of the arch frame installation trolley.

The core components of the arch frame installation vehicle include:
1. Chassis: This is the foundation of the entire equipment, providing mobility and support. The choice of chassis determines the stability and adaptability of the arch frame installation vehicle.
2. Front and Rear Outriggers: These outriggers stabilize the vehicle during operation, ensuring safety and accuracy. The outriggers are height-adjustable to adapt to different terrains and working environments.
3. Subframe: Mounted on the chassis, it supports and connects other critical components. The design and material selection of the subframe are crucial, requiring sufficient strength and rigidity.
4. Slide Table: Used for moving and positioning arch frame components. The slide table can move horizontally and vertically, providing flexible operating space.
5. Robotic Arm: This is one of the important components of the installation vehicle, responsible for gripping and installing the arch frame. Robotic arms typically possess multiple degrees of freedom, allowing for flexible adjustment of posture and position to adapt to diverse installation requirements.
6. Work Platform: Provides a safe working area for operators. Work platforms are usually equipped with safety railings and anti-slip devices to ensure operator safety when working at heights.
7. Robotic Arm: Installed at the end of the robotic arm, used to grasp and secure arch components. The robotic arm's design should ensure stability and precision in grasping, preventing loosening or slippage during installation.
8. Auxiliary Arm: Used to assist the robotic arm in performing complex operations. The auxiliary arm provides additional support and force, making the installation process smoother and more efficient.
9. Hydraulic Winch: Used for lifting and lowering heavy objects. The hydraulic winch system has high load-bearing capacity and control precision, ensuring the stability of the object during lifting.
